Output e275cd7714f5f5387671a963ebe394023af42a726a7ebc50ac3eb4238d3280e6:1

value
27427281536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cf059efa310f099a8d44f54150f918c24835bc3 OP_EQUAL
address
3MqEWeZa6XRPnLNZXnurddxn8GAE8VPfsW
transaction
e275cd7714f5f5387671a963ebe394023af42a726a7ebc50ac3eb4238d3280e6
spent
true